【计算机类职业资格】国家二级VF机试(数据库及其操作)模拟试卷9及答案解析.doc
《【计算机类职业资格】国家二级VF机试(数据库及其操作)模拟试卷9及答案解析.doc》由会员分享,可在线阅读,更多相关《【计算机类职业资格】国家二级VF机试(数据库及其操作)模拟试卷9及答案解析.doc(9页珍藏版)》请在麦多课文档分享上搜索。
1、国家二级 VF机试(数据库及其操作)模拟试卷 9及答案解析(总分:54.00,做题时间:90 分钟)一、选择题(总题数:27,分数:54.00)1.打开数据库的命令是(分数:2.00)A.USEB.USE DATABASEC.OPEND.OPEN DATABASE2.操作对象只能是一个表的关系运算是(分数:2.00)A.联系和选择B.联接个投影C.选择和投影D.自然连接和选择3.MODIFY STRUCTURE命令的功能是(分数:2.00)A.修改记录值B.修改表结构C.修改数据库结构D.修改数据库或表结构4.在数据库中建立表的命令是(分数:2.00)A.CREATEB.CREATE DATA
2、BASEC.CREATE QUERYD.CREATE FORM5.在 Visual FoxPro中,为了使表具有更多的特性应该使用(分数:2.00)A.数据库表B.自由表C.数据库表或自由表D.数据库表和自由表6.在 Visual FoxPro中,为了使表具有更多的特性,应该使用(分数:2.00)A.数据库表B.自由表C.数据库表和自由表D.数据库表或自由表7.以下关于空值(NULL 值)叙述正确的是(分数:2.00)A.空值等于空字符串B.空值等同于数值 0C.空值表示字段或变量还没有确定的值D.Visual FoxPro不支持空值8.设数据库表中有一个 C型字段 NAME,打开表文件后,要
3、把内存变量 CC的字符串内容输入到当前记录的NAME字段,应当使用命令:(分数:2.00)A.NAME=CCB.REPLACE NAME WITH CCC.STORE CC TO NAMED.REPLACE ALL NAME WITH CC9.设数据库表中有一个 C型字段 NAME。打开表文件后,要把内存变量 NAME的字符串内容输入到当前记录的 NAME字段,应当使用命令(分数:2.00)A.NAME=NAMEB.NAME=MNAMEC.STORE MNAME TO NAMED.REPLACE NAME WITH MNAME10.如果在命令窗口执行命令“LIST 名称”后主窗口中显示记录号
4、名称 1 电视机 2 计算机 3 电话线 4 电冰箱 5 电线假定名称字段为字符型,宽度为 6,那么下面程序段的输出结果是 GO 2SCAN NEXT 4 FOR LEFT(名称,2)=“电“IF RIGHT(名称,2)=“线“EXITENDIFENDSCAN?名称(分数:2.00)A.电话线B.电线C.电冰箱D.电视机11.在当前打开的表中,显示“书名”以“计算机”开头的所有图书,下列命令中正确的是(分数:2.00)A.list for 书名=“计算机“B.list for 书名=“计算机“C.list for 书名=“计算机“D.list where 书名=“计算机“12.设有两个数据库表
5、,父表和子表之间是一对多的联系,为控制子表和父表的联系,可以设置“参照完整性规则”,为此要求这两个表(分数:2.00)A.在父表连接字段上建立普通索引,在子表连接字段上建立主索引B.在父表连接字段上建立主索引,在子表连接字段上建立普通索引C.在父表连接字段上不需要建立任何索引,在字表连接字段上建立普通索引D.在父表和子表的连接字段上都要建立主索引13.可以随表的打开而自动打开的索引是(分数:2.00)A.单项压缩索引文件B.单项索引文件C.结构复合索引文件D.非结构复合索引文件14.在 Visual FoxPro的数据库表中只能有一个(分数:2.00)A.候选索引B.普通索引C.主索引D.惟一
6、索引15.使用索引的主要目的是(分数:2.00)A.提高查询速度B.节省存储空间C.防止数据丢失D.方便管理16.在数据库中建立索引的目的是(分数:2.00)A.节省存储空间B.提高查询速度C.提高查询和更新速度D.提高更新速度17.Visual FoxPro支持的索引文件不包括(分数:2.00)A.独立索引文件B.规则索引文件C.复合索引文件D.结构复合索引文件18.为表中一些字段创建普通索引的目的是(分数:2.00)A.改变表中记录的物理顺序B.确保实体完整性约束C.加快数据库表的更新速度D.加快数据库表的查询速度19.己知表中有字符型字段“职称”和“性别”,要建立一个索引,要求首先按“职
7、称”排序,“职称”相同时再按“性别”排序,正确的命令是(分数:2.00)A.INDEX ON 职称+性别 TO tttB.INDEX ON 性别+职称 TO tttC.INDEX ON 职称,性别 TO tttD.INDEX ON 性别,职称 TO ttt20.在创建数据库表结构时,为了同时定义实体完整性可以通过指定哪类索引来实现(分数:2.00)A.惟一索引B.主索引C.复合索引D.普通索引21.参照完整性规则的更新规则中“级联”的含义是(分数:2.00)A.更新父表中的连接字段值时,用新的连接字段值自动修改字表中的所有相关记录B.若子表中有与父表相关的记录,则禁止修改父表中的连接字段值C.
8、父表中的连接字段值可以随意更新,不会影响子表中的记录D.父表中的连接字段值在任何情况下都不允许更新22.在 Visual FoxPro中,有关参照完整性的删除规则正确的描述是(分数:2.00)A.如果删除规则选择的是“限制”,则当用户删除父表中的记录时,系统将自动删除子表中的所有相关记录B.如果删除规则选择的是“级联”,则当用户删除父表中的记录时,系统将禁止删除与子表相关的父表中的记录C.如果删除规则选择的是“忽略”,则当用户删除父表中的记录时,系统不负责检查子表中是否有相关记录D.上面三种说法都不对23.在 Visual FoxPro中,如果在表之间的联系中设置了参照完整性规则,并在删除规则
9、中选择了“级联”,当删除父表中的记录,其结果是(分数:2.00)A.只删除父表中的记录,不影响子表B.任何时候都拒绝删除父表中的记录C.在删除父表中记录的同时自动删除子表中的所有参照记录D.若子表中有参照记录,则禁止删除父表中记录24.在 Visual FoxPro中,参照完整性规则不包括(分数:2.00)A.更新规则B.查询规则C.删除规则D.插入规则25.在 Visual FoxPro中,自由表不能建立的索引是(分数:2.00)A.主索引B.候选索引C.惟一索引D.普通索引26.在 Visual FoxPro中,下面的描述中正确是(分数:2.00)A.打开一个数据库以后建立的表是自由表B.
10、没有打开任何数据库时建立的表是自由表C.可以为自由表指定字段级规则D.可以为自由表指定参照完整性规则27.命令“SELECT 0”的功能是(分数:2.00)A.选择编号最小的未使用工作区B.选择 0号工作区C.关闭当前工作区中的表D.选择当前工作区国家二级 VF机试(数据库及其操作)模拟试卷 9答案解析(总分:54.00,做题时间:90 分钟)一、选择题(总题数:27,分数:54.00)1.打开数据库的命令是(分数:2.00)A.USEB.USE DATABASEC.OPEND.OPEN DATABASE 解析:解析:打开数据库的命令是 OPEN DATABASE,具体语法格式是:OPEN D
11、ATABASE【数据库名】,而打开数据表的命令是 USE。2.操作对象只能是一个表的关系运算是(分数:2.00)A.联系和选择B.联接个投影C.选择和投影 D.自然连接和选择解析:解析:选择运算是从关系模式中找出符合条件的元组的操作。选择的条件以逻辑表达式给出,其中逻辑表达式值为真的元组将被选取。投影运算是从关系模式中指定若干个属性组成新的关系。这两个运算都是对同一个表进行操作。3.MODIFY STRUCTURE命令的功能是(分数:2.00)A.修改记录值B.修改表结构 C.修改数据库结构D.修改数据库或表结构解析:解析:MODIFY STRUCTURE 的作用是打开表结构设计器,修改表结构
12、。4.在数据库中建立表的命令是(分数:2.00)A.CREATE B.CREATE DATABASEC.CREATE QUERYD.CREATE FORM解析:解析:在 Visual FoxPro中建立数据库表有 3种方法:通过项目管理器建立数据库表;在数据库设计器中建立数据库表;通过命令方式建立数据库表。其中通过命令方式建立数据库表的格式是:CREATETableName5.在 Visual FoxPro中,为了使表具有更多的特性应该使用(分数:2.00)A.数据库表 B.自由表C.数据库表或自由表D.数据库表和自由表解析:解析:数据库表与自由表相比,有如下特点:数据库表可以使用长表名、长字
13、段名;可以为数据库表中的字段指定标题和添加注释;可以为数据库表中的字段指定默认值和输入掩码;数据库表的字段有默认的控件类;可以为数据库表规定字段级规则和记录级规则;数据库表支持主关键字、参照完整性和表之间的关联。6.在 Visual FoxPro中,为了使表具有更多的特性,应该使用(分数:2.00)A.数据库表 B.自由表C.数据库表和自由表D.数据库表或自由表解析:解析:本题考查数据库表与自由表的区别。数据库表与自由表相比,有如下特点:数据库表可以使用长表名、长字段名;可以为数据库表中的字段指定标题和添加注释;可以为数据库表中的字段指定默认值和输入掩码;数据库表的字段有默认的控件类;可以为数
14、据库表规定字段级规则和记录级规则;数据库表支持主关键字、参照完整性和表之间的关联。7.以下关于空值(NULL 值)叙述正确的是(分数:2.00)A.空值等于空字符串B.空值等同于数值 0C.空值表示字段或变量还没有确定的值 D.Visual FoxPro不支持空值解析:解析:空值(NULL 值)表示字段或变量还没有确定的值,它与空字符串和数值 0有不同的含义,空值就是缺值或不确定值,不能把它理解为任何意义的数据。8.设数据库表中有一个 C型字段 NAME,打开表文件后,要把内存变量 CC的字符串内容输入到当前记录的NAME字段,应当使用命令:(分数:2.00)A.NAME=CCB.REPLAC
15、E NAME WITH CC C.STORE CC TO NAMED.REPLACE ALL NAME WITH CC解析:解析:本题考查 REPLACE命令的使用。要对当前表中字段的更新,使用 replace命令,其格式为:REPLACE字段名 1WITH表达式 1,字段名 2WITH表达式 2FOR条件|范围子句,而 STORE是赋值命令,其命令格式为 store数值 to变量名。9.设数据库表中有一个 C型字段 NAME。打开表文件后,要把内存变量 NAME的字符串内容输入到当前记录的 NAME字段,应当使用命令(分数:2.00)A.NAME=NAMEB.NAME=MNAMEC.STOR
- 1.请仔细阅读文档,确保文档完整性,对于不预览、不比对内容而直接下载带来的问题本站不予受理。
- 2.下载的文档,不会出现我们的网址水印。
- 3、该文档所得收入(下载+内容+预览)归上传者、原创作者;如果您是本文档原作者,请点此认领!既往收益都归您。
下载文档到电脑,查找使用更方便
5000 积分 0人已下载
下载 | 加入VIP,交流精品资源 |
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 计算机 职业资格 国家 二级 VF 机试 数据库 及其 操作 模拟 试卷 答案 解析 DOC
